A man is fighting for life in hospital after being attacked by six strangers in Sydney’s CBD.

The attack occurred in the early hours of May 23 on the corner of George and Liverpool streets.

Police were told a 25-year-old man became involved in a physical altercation with six men he didn’t know.

He suffered a fractured skull and bleeding on the brain.

He was treated at the scene before being taken to St Vincent’s Hospital, where he remains in a critical condition.

Police released images of the men they’d like to speak to.

The six men fled the scene in a blue Holden Commodore, driving north along Kent Street.

Detectives have since established Strike Force Stockdale to investigate the assault.

As part of their inquiries, investigators have released images of six men they would like to speak to.

All men are described as being of Indian Sub-Continental appearance.

The first man is described as being 180-185cm tall, of solid build, with facial hair and short black hair. He is depicted wearing a blue puffer jacket and a blue and red Ellesse branded shirt and jeans.

Police also released images of the Holden Commodore.

Anyone with information is asked to contact the police.
